About

Twist Bioscience was founded in 2013 in San Francisco by Emily Leproust, Bill Banyai, and Bill Peck, pioneering a silicon-based DNA synthesis platform that writes synthetic DNA at a fraction of the cost and error rate of conventional methods. By printing DNA on silicon wafers using a semiconductor-like process, Twist dramatically reduced the cost of synthetic genes from hundreds to single-digit dollars per gene, democratizing access to DNA writing for the life sciences.\n\nTwist serves over 3,000 customers across biopharmaceuticals, academic research, agriculture, and industrial biotechnology, offering synthetic genes, variant libraries, DNA data storage oligos, and antibody libraries for drug discovery. The company reported $376.6 million in FY2025 revenue, up 20% from $313 million in FY2024, driven by strong growth in its biopharma and drug discovery segments. Twist also operates a growing antibody drug discovery business, providing synthetic antibody libraries that power next-generation therapeutic discovery programs.\n\nTwist has a supply agreement with Ginkgo Bioworks for synthetic DNA to fuel Ginkgo's cell engineering platform, revised in 2025. The company is executing toward profitability, with improving gross margins as manufacturing scale increases. Its silicon-based DNA synthesis platform positions it as critical infrastructure for the emerging bioeconomy, synthetic biology, and DNA data storage industries.

About

Umoja Biopharma is developing an in vivo CAR-T cell therapy platform that circumvents the costly and time-consuming ex vivo manufacturing process that limits current CAR-T therapies. Instead of extracting a patient's T-cells, engineering them in a lab, and reinfusing them, Umoja's approach delivers viral vectors intravenously that reprogram T-cells directly inside the patient's body. This could reduce CAR-T therapy costs from $400,000+ to a fraction of that price.
